B&H Exports Increased by 6,5 Percent

Published November 18, 2013
Share
SHARE

uvoz-izvoz2In the last ten months, B&H exported goods valued at around seven billion BAM, which is 6,5 percent more than in the same period last year, in 2012. Imports amounted to around 2,5 billion BAM, which is 2,5 percent less than in the same period last year.

B&H exports increased by 6,5 percent. In the period under import-export ratio it was 55,7 percent, while the foreign trade deficit amounted to around six billion BAM, announced the B&H Agency for Statistics.

Exports to EU countries for ten months amounted to around 5,2 billion BAM, which is 8,1 percent more than in the same period in 2012, while imports amounted to around 7,6 billion BAM, which is three percent less than in the same period last year. Export-import ratio was 68,4 percent.

(Source: klix.ba)
